Abstract

The invention relates to a special leaf fertilizer for tea and a topdressing method thereof. The leaf fertilizer is prepared by mixing biogas slurry and clean water according to a ratio of 1 liter of the biogas slurry and 1-2 liters of the clean water. The topdressing method comprises the following steps of: preparing the leaf fertilizer according to the ratio of the biogas slurry to the clean water being 1L to 1L before the tea sprouts in summer; spraying the leaf fertilizer 15 days before the tea sprouts and spraying again after 5-6 days; uniformly spraying leaf surfaces and trunks, wherein the fertilizing amount is 100-120KG per Mu; after spring tea is finished, preparing the leaf fertilizer according to the ratio of the biogas slurry to the clean water being 1L to 2L; after the spring tea is finished, immediately spraying the leaf fertilizer and spraying again after 5-6 days; and uniformly spraying the leaf surfaces, leaf backs and spring twigs, wherein the fertilizing amount is 50-60 KG per Mu and in each time of spraying needs to be finished within two days. After the leaf fertilizer is applied, the tea can sprout in advance 3-5 days before and about 17% of fresh tea can be increased per Mu; buds orderly sprout and are stout and strong, and the color is deep; the content of amino acid of the tea is high and the taste is sweet; the tea can be brewed for a long time; the flavor is high and lasting; and the teat is organic and healthy. Therefore, the biogas slurry is used as a main raw material of the leaf fertilizer to replace a special leaf fertilizer for tea which is quickly and chemically synthesized; and the special leaf fertilizer is ecological, environment-friendly and energy-saving and can be sustainably developed and utilized.

Background technology
Tealeaves special-purpose foliage fertilizer market sale title is of a great variety, and the tealeaves face sprays foliage fertilizer, and to germinate ahead of time, improving output and quality is purpose.Foliage fertilizer adopts the physics and chemistry synthetic technology to be processed as multi-elements composite fertilizer more, mainly synthetic with various trace elements such as nitrogen, phosphorus, boron, zinc, violent, iron, aluminium, stimulate adjusting bud-leaf top nutrient deficiency disease by foliage-spray, the extra-nutrition fertility, thus reach the purpose that tealeaves germinates ahead of time, improves output and quality.
Because food-safety problem becomes increasingly conspicuous at present, tealeaves is as the mankind's nourishing drink, in process of production, requirement with organic tea production standard technical regulation plant, standard technique management such as fertilising, insect pest preventing and controlling, processing, wherein organic tea standardized production technical regulation requires: in fertilizer practice, based on fertilizer, Shaoshi or do not execute chemical fertilizer or quick-acting fertilizer as far as possible; Insect pest preventing and controlling requires based on physical control, and efficient, low residue chemical pesticide is auxilliary.
Yet, Shaoshi or do not execute the tealeaves special-purpose foliage fertilizer and can not reach the effect of germinateing ahead of time and improving output and quality; And repeatedly or often use the tealeaves special-purpose foliage fertilizer not reach the purpose that organic tea is produced, and not meeting Organic food safety in production requirement, the economic benefit of product and social benefit will reduce.
In view of this situation, launch gradually at the research of tealeaves special-purpose foliage fertilizer, for example:
Disclosed in a kind of liquid type tea leaf surface composite fertilizer of notification number CN101100404B is composite nitrogen, phosphorus, potassium macronutrient and middle amount and micronutrient element in water, and its content is (N and P 2O 5And K 2O) 50-200G/L, (MG and/or CA) 5-20G/L, (ZN and/or MO and/or MN and/or B and/or FE and/or CU) 10-60G/L; Sequestrant 3-10G/L, wetting agent 0.05-0.3G/L.With macronutrient nitrogen, phosphorus, potassium soluble in water solution A, in, micronutrient element soluble in water solution B, in B solution, add sequestrant in 60-80 ℃ of following stirring reaction 0.5-2 hour, the cooling back is composite with A solution, adds wetting agent and stirs.This composite fertilizer converts the water dilution and sprays on the tealeaves, on the blade face, middle part for 800 times, and tealeaves is gathered and begun to spray in preceding 30 days, sprays once in 7-8 days at interval.
Organic tea leaven that a kind of chitosan of publication number CN101050144A is composite and preparation method thereof, the composite organic tea leaven of the chitosan that provides comprises chitosan and hydrotropy additive, the hydrotropy additive is made up of solubility promoter and nutritional additive, be chitosan by quality than chitosan and hydrotropy content of additive: hydrotropy additive=1: 10~15, solubility promoter: nutritional additive=1: 0.5~0.75.During preparation, the poly-chaff of shell is packaged into chitosan powder with powder form; Be packaged into the hydrotropy additive solution after solubility promoter and nutritional additive mixed according to the above ratio.During use, chitosan powder and hydrotropy additive solution are mixed, dilute with water gets final product, and the consumption of water is chitosan powder and hydrotropy additive solution mixture 500~800 times.Can significantly promote the growth of tea cyanines, improve tea yield, can also improve the tender property of holding of tealeaves simultaneously, improve tea leaf quality.
A kind of biological bacteria liquid tea leaf surface fertilizer and the production method thereof of publication number CN102992822A, the fertile precentagewise proportioning of disclosed tea leaf surface is: root nodule bacterium 0.02%-1.8%; Vinelandii 0.03%-1.5%; Sporeformer 0.02%-1.6%; Potassium bacterium 0.02%-1.0%; Phosphorus bacteria 0.03%-1.8%; Protein 3%-8%; Ethrel 0.1%-10%; Nitrogen 2.8-15%; Molybdenum 0.8%-6%; Boron 0.6-8%; Surplus is pure water.Send temperature according to boiler---inoculation---the one-level cultivation time; Add three kinds of biological inoculums---batching---the secondary cultivation time: the secondary cultivation adds trace element, protein-three grade fermemtation; Three grades add ethrel, nitrogen, molybdenum, and------ripe bacterium liquid---detects---outbound---cold storage in cultivation.After this foliage fertilizer is sprayed onto tealeaves roots of plants, top, by these biological life Metabolic activities widely, infect, transmit, fermentation, the very fast absorption of the function of tethelin and farm crop, supply with the various nutrients of N, P, K of crop, impel that crop absorption is fast, growth is fast.
Above-mentioned disclosed tea leaf surface fertilizer technology still is the multi-elements composite fertilizer that adopts the physics and chemistry synthetic technology to process; Also has certain distance with real fertilizer.
Therefore, how selecting real fertilizer as tea leaf surface fertilizer, is the problem that the organic tea standardized production of tealeaves must solve.

Beneficial effect:
Natural pond liquid is the common and organic fertilizer of extensive utilization among the real human lives, it is the product of ecology in the life in the countryside, environmental protection, Sustainable development power-saving technology, be to be widely used in the fertilizer that farm crop, vegetables etc. produce, meet the requirement of organic tea production fertilizer practice as foliage fertilizer.
Because natural pond liquid is tame animal manure, urine such as pig, ox, chicken, sheep, the product after process vigor is fully fermented, nutritive element is comprehensive, fertility is high, has the effect of desinsection, sterilization concurrently.Tealeaves sprays after this is the foliage fertilizer of main raw material with natural pond liquid, can germinate ahead of time 3-5 days, and mu volume increase Fresh Folium Camelliae sinensis about 17%, bud hair bud is neat, stout and strong, and blade is thick, and the leaf color depth is remote, tealeaves aminoacids content height, flavor is sweet, endures repeated infusions, and is fragrant high lasting; The organic health of tea products, the economical, societal benefits height.
Therefore, substitute the tealeaves special-purpose foliage fertilizer of quick-acting chemosynthesis, ecological environment-friendly energy-saving, Sustainable development utilization with natural pond liquid as the main raw material of foliage fertilizer.Utilize fertilizer natural pond liquid namely to utilize fertilizer, also realized the agrotechnique of ecological, environmental protective Sustainable development.
